我想要我公司开发服务器的特定 URL 结构。 我们有几个网站,我将它们放在一台服务器上,但每个网站都可以访问相同的库和配置文件,以便将来轻松添加另一个网站。 我想要的 URL 结构是这样的:
htp://internalFolder.devName.internalUrl/
htp://www.mywebsite.com.project.web.devname.company.com/index.php
文件夹结构如下:
/home/devname/project/lib/
/home/devname/project/config/
/home/devname/project/web/www.mywebsite.com/
/home/devname/project/web/www.website2.com/
... url 必须访问这些文件夹,如果开发人员在他的文件夹中创建了一个临时文件夹,他就可以访问它:
/home/devname/temp/
htp://temp.devname.company.com/
我不知道该怎么做...我在 Windows Server 2008 中有一个 DNS 服务器,在 Debian 上有我的开发服务器,如果可能的话,我将 Linux 服务器作为辅助 DNS 或类似的东西。 我知道这是可能的,因为这是我前公司的结构,而且非常好。
非常感谢您的回复。
最佳答案
如果它们全部从同一网络服务器运行,则与 DNS 没有太大关系(只要您可以将所有这些 URL 获取到同一网络服务器的 IP。
在 apache 中,这些不同的站点被称为 Virtual Hosts .
关于windows - 内部网站的url结构,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8089006/